The record

German racing driver and McLaren factory driver since 2022 who won the 2023 Goodwood Timed Shootout in a Solus GT.

Born in Leipzig on 19 March 1994, Kirchhöfer made his Formula ADAC debut in 2012. Driving for Lotus, he won the championship with nine wins and 329 points, ahead of Gustav Malja. He returned to Lotus (Motopark) for the 2013 ATS Formel 3 Cup, taking the title with 13 wins and 511 points in a Dallara F308-VW.

He raced in GP3 for ART Grand Prix in 2014 and 2015, finishing third in both seasons: one win in the first and five in the second. In 2015, Esteban Ocon and Luca Ghiotto placed ahead of him. He then competed in GP2 for Carlin in 2016, finishing 17th after 20 races and runner-up in Monaco’s sprint race, before moving to GT racing in 2017.

McLaren Automotive added Kirchhöfer to its factory-driver line-up ahead of the 2022 season. The contemporary announcement combined racing with development of McLaren motorsport products and driving activities including the Pure programme. McLaren’s 2026 roster again listed him among its Factory Drivers, while GT World Challenge Europe records his Garage 59 McLaren 720S GT3 EVO programme in its Sprint and Endurance Cups.

At the 2023 Goodwood Festival of Speed, Kirchhöfer drove the Solus GT in the Timed Shootout. Goodwood described the car as still in development and reported the McLaren factory driver’s 45.34-second winning run.
